We currently only offer a 2" piano hinge with a 1/4" diameter pin in a 72" length so you would need to purchase two and cut one down to cover the rest of the 83-1/2" of length you're needing.
In the USA a tandem axle utility trailer with a g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R) of 7500-lbs should have brakes installed. Any trailer over 3000-lbs must have brakes on all wheels in most states, but laws do vary. Some states require braked axles…

Secure and Organize Your Gear with Backpack Blower Racks
Backpack blower racks are essential for keeping your equipment organized and secure during transport. Designed to fit various blower models, these racks help prevent damage and save space in your trailer or truck. Consider the compatibility with your blower model and the durability of materials when choosing a rack.
Backpack blower racks are versatile and can accommodate various models, but some may require adapters for a perfect fit. It's important to check compatibility with your specific blower model to ensure a secure hold. Some users have modified racks for better fit, especially with brands like Husqvarna.
While generally sturdy, some racks have issues with straps and rubber components degrading over time, especially when exposed to the elements. Replacing straps with higher quality ones can enhance longevity. Welds may also need reinforcement if they show signs of wear.
Design features like wider hooks or fork designs can improve stability and ease of use. Some racks benefit from additional bungee cords to secure blower tubes. Consider racks with adjustable components to better fit your specific equipment and trailer setup.
In enclosed trailers, racks perform well, keeping equipment secure and organized. In open setups, wind can cause blowers to move, potentially damaging them. It's crucial to secure blowers properly and consider additional support to prevent movement during transport.
Installation is generally straightforward, but may require some adjustments like notching trailer boards or using specific bolts for a secure fit. Ensure the rack is mounted securely to prevent movement. Using locking washers and nuts can enhance stability.
